Open Admission Regarding Weight Loss Journey And Ozempic Use

Bynes has been remarkably candid about the methods behind her transformation. In December, she shared a paparazzi photo on her Instagram Stories and said she was already looking better after taking Ozempic for months.

'I usually don't like paparazzi pictures bc I was 180lbs, but now I've lost 28lbs on Ozempic! I'm down to 152lbs,' she wrote. 'I know I still look big but this photo is really inspiring to me!'

Ozempic is a medication originally designed for type 2 diabetes. However, Hollywood celebrities have been using it for weight loss.

Bynes announced in June in an Instagram video that she was 'going on Ozempic.' She expressed her excitement at the time about using the drug to trim down her excess weight.

'Oh, I'm going on Ozempic. So excited. I'm 173 now, so I hope to get down to like 130, which would be awesome, so I look better in paparazzi pictures,' she announced. 'I will post about my Ozempic journey, of course.'

By choosing to speak openly about her Ozempic use, she joined a growing list of public figures who have demystified the use of pharmaceutical aids for weight management. Her transparency was met with a mix of support and curiosity from fans who have followed her career since her early days on Nickelodeon.

Legacy Of A Child Star

Amanda Bynes rose to international prominence as a comedic prodigy, starring in hit television series such as All That and The Amanda Show. Her transition to film was equally successful, with leading roles in popular comedies including What a Girl Wants and She's the Man.

However, her once-prolific career stalled after her last film appearance in 2010's Easy A, after which she announced a hiatus from acting. The reasons for her withdrawal from the industry are complex, involving high-profile legal struggles and a decade-long conservatorship that ended in 2022.

While fans often express hope for a professional comeback, Bynes has focused on personal pursuits. Bynes tried a podcast but immediately moved on from it. She said she was more interested in getting her manicurist licence, despite the first episode of her podcast doing better than she expected, because she wanted a 'consistent job.'
